Internships and Clerkships
One most common ways for law students gain practical experience through Internships and Clerkships. These opportunities allow students to work in a legal setting, gaining exposure to the day-to-day operations of a law firm or corporate legal department. According to the American Bar Association, 83% of law students have completed at least one internship before graduating, with 45% completing two or more internships.

Entry-Level Legal Assistant Positions
Another option for law students with no experience is to seek entry-level positions as legal assistants or paralegals. These roles often require minimal experience and provide an opportunity to work closely with attorneys and gain valuable insights into the legal profession.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the employment of paralegals and legal assistants is projected to grow 10% from 2020 to 2030, faster than the average for all occupations.

Volunteer Work and Pro Bono Opportunities
Volunteering for non-profit organizations, legal aid clinics, or pro bono projects can also provide law students with valuable experience. These opportunities allow students to make a difference in their communities while honing their legal skills and building a professional network. According to a survey by the National Association for Law Placement, 80% of law firms have a formal pro bono program in place.

Exploring Opportunities: Law Student Jobs with No Experience
Are you a law student looking to jumpstart your career? Curious about landing a job in the legal field without prior experience? Here are some popular legal questions and answers to help guide you through this exciting journey!
Legal Question | Expert Answer |
---|---|
1. Can I secure a legal job as a law student with no prior experience? | Absolutely! Many law firms and legal organizations offer internships or entry-level positions specifically designed for law students with minimal experience. Look out for opportunities that value your educational background and eagerness to learn. |
2. What are some effective ways to stand out in job applications without professional experience? | Highlight any relevant coursework, legal research projects, or law-related extracurricular activities in your resume. Emphasize your strong work ethic, passion for the law, and willingness to tackle new challenges. Personalize your cover letter to showcase your genuine enthusiasm for the position. |
3. Is networking important for law students seeking entry-level jobs? | Absolutely. Networking with legal professionals, attending industry events, and joining law student associations can provide valuable connections and insights. Don`t underestimate the power of building meaningful relationships in the legal community. |
4. How can I gain practical legal experience if I haven`t worked in the field before? | Consider pro bono opportunities, volunteering at legal clinics, or participating in moot court competitions. These experiences can offer hands-on exposure to legal work and demonstrate your dedication to the field. |
5. Are there specific job search strategies tailored for law students with no experience? | Look for entry-level positions, summer associate programs, or law clerk roles designed for students. Utilize career services at your law school for job postings, resume workshops, and mock interviews. Leverage online resources such as legal job boards and professional networking sites. |
